PRO-330: Sound Imaging Starter kit

Track the noise with images

NetdB PRO-330: Sound Imaging starter kit.
NetdB-DAQ6 with a 6 channel linear array of microphones driven by dBVISION Pro-software package: a most compact solution providing the unrivaled accuracy of Nearfield Acoustical Holography for noise sources localization.

The power of Nearfield Acoustical Holography (NAH) in this starter package providing you with the minimum set of tools for tracking your first noise images!

NetdB PRO-330 based on a 6ch expandable data acquisition platform is an ideal system for small to medium size objects,offering:

  • Best accuracy in noise Source localization
  • Holography, Intensity and partial power processing functions
  • Source quantification through immediate radiated power evaluation (global & partial)
  • Expandabililty to capturing the real test situation (RELAX technology)

PRO-330 Technical Specifications

Acoustic Array

  • Number of microphones: 6 (expandable to 12)
  • Microphone spacing: 5 cm (possibility of overlapping measurements to increase the mesh density)
  • Total weight: 350 g
  • Handle/Remote control unit: Start/stop commands integrated, hinged system for a better accessibility to confined regions
  • Connectors: 6 BNC connected to the NetdB, serial port connected to the computer for the remote control

Microphones

  • Diameter: ¼ inch
  • Output connector: SMB coaxial socket
  • Length: 60.0 mm
  • Weight: 5.5 g
  • Sensitivity at 250 Hz: 8 mV/Pa (nominal)
  • Dynamic range:
    Lower limit < 30 dBA re. 20µPa
    Upper limit 138 dB re. 20µPa
  • Frequency response:
    100 Hz - 3 kHz ± 1dB
    3 kHz - 10 kHz ± 2dB
  • Output impedance: < 50 Ohm
  • Phase Match:
    100 Hz - 3 kHz: ± 3°
    3 kHz - 5 kHz: ± 5°
  • Temperature Range: -10 °C to +50 °C
  • Power supply: 2 mA to 20 mA (typically 4 mA)

NetdB 12 channels

  • Dimensions: 250mm(W) x 85mm(H) x 263mm(D) excluding projections
  • Weight: 4.5 kg
  • Input channels: 12 dynamic channels with IEPE power supply
  • Digitization: 24 bits
  • Sampling frequency:     51.2kHz, 25.6kHz, 12.8kHz
  • Ranges:
    - 20 dB: 14.1 V peak or 10 V RMS
    - 0 dB: 1.41 V peak or 1 V RMS
    - +20 dB : 141 mV peak or 100 mV RMS
  • SNR: > - 105 dB RMS of the full scale
  • Data storage: 100 GB HDD (12 hours of continuous measurement @ 12 channels 51.2KHz 24bit)
  • Output channels: 2 x BNC connectors
  • Phones: Jack connector - Stereo output for Headphones
  • Digital Input/Output: RCA connector for SPDIF In/Out digital audio
  • Power: 20 W
  • Voltage: 12 to 14 VDC          
  • Max current: 3.5 A
  • Battery life: 2 hours as a stand alone solution   
  • Adapter: AC 110 V / 250 V

Software for Recording/Analysis

dBVision-PRO software package:

  • Planar or Cylindrical holography (up to customer's choice),
  • Intensity maps
  • Reporting Module
  • Data import/export to MatlabTM
  • 3D View graphics capabilities/photo-image superimposition
  • Global Power computation

Source Ranking module:

Partial power computations and Source ranking according to selected zones (patch definition)

Software Options

  • dBVision TL: Transmission Loss computations possibly using selected zones definition (patch definition)
  • dBVision FAR: Far-field predictions capabilities, radiations patterns (directivity, polar diagrams, ...)
  • dBVision EARPREDICT: CABIN Noise level predictions at arbitrary location inside an enclosure
  • dBVision RELAX: Automatic projection of measurement data onto regular grids from arbitrary antenna locations
  • dBVISION IPS: Data acquisition/management with Instrumentation Positioning System of dBVision
